Feel good about supporting this local business as they also pay attention to reducing their carbon footprint using renewable energy sources as much as possible, limiting waste, collecting rainwater, and purchasing the production resources locally.

There’s a major community feel here since Ferm is always welcoming locals and tourists alike to learn about local farming. You’ll be picking in-season fruits and flowers and supporting local business at Ferm. You’re welcome, Mother Nature!

  • Pick your own apples, strawberries, and other fruits as well as some vegetables, and flowers, all organically grown for the surrounding community. If you don’t want to harvest for yourself, you can always shop here and get fresh herbs, fruits, veggies, and flowers. Fresh vegetable sales happen every Wednesday during the summer time. Otherwise, get to pickin’ any day of the week when you see a crop is ready!
  • Pick your own flowers: From June until September! Bring along the whole family and get picking. The flowers go great as extra decor on dishes or around your house!
  • Edible flowers! At Ferm Zemst you can also pick edible flowers and make tea from them. They say these organic flower gardens will bring you back to nature and are key to an eco-friendly future.
  • Join in with the community and be part of the educational and skill-building workshops, tours, open days, and events.

Tips and Tricks

  • Book your slot for a workshop in advance, they do fill up!
  • Pick your own flowers from June until September; keep an eye on the website for any off-season activities.
  • Bring your own knife for harvesting along with any other supplies.

Getting There

  • By Car: Parking available on site
  • By Bus: 18 min walk from bus stop Hombeek Plein
